The 75-Minute Chicago River Architecture Cruise by Shoreline is a sightseeing cruise along the Chicago River, taking in the city's celebrated skyline from the water. Chicago's river corridor is lined with more than 50 architecturally significant buildings, including works by Louis Sullivan, Mies van der Rohe, and Helmut Jahn, making it one of the most concentrated stretches of modern and early 20th-century architecture in North America.
An onboard guide narrates the cruise, identifying key structures such as the Tribune Tower, the Wrigley Building, and Marina City as the boat moves through the main and north branches of the river. The 75-minute runtime keeps the pace steady without rushing past major landmarks.
